yuik is an abstract widget library for creating GUIs. The actual frontend can be chosen at runtime which allows the program to run under Tk, as a shell program, and even as a web-application. More frontends like an irc-bot, wxWidgets, or XUL are planned.
wxBrowser is an application browser based on the wxWidgets GUI framework. It's similar to a regular old web browser only, instead of reading HTML and displaying content it reads XML and executes presentation logic (wxPython) in a client side application.
A simple, yet powerful framework built around the OGRE rendering system. Has many features in the works such as AI, Audio, an entity system (much like CEL), and a complete level editor.
iwftools is a set of tools and libraries for developers of digital imaging workflow applications. It consists of generic Python components for this purpose, as well as an reference application. It is implemented without any OS specific dependencies.

A content generation engine written in Python used for generating content for HTML and textual output. Integrates with Apache to form a web framework that uses XML templates and can embed Python.
NiL is a modular multi-purpose gaming engine including a multiplayer worm game a little like quake, except it's 2d and a little like worms except it's realtime.
ACDK - Artefaktur Component Development Kit - is a platform independent C++-framework similar to Java or C#/.NET for generating distributed and scriptable components and applications.
Uraga aims to create a CPAN like package installation and management system for Python.
Uraga will allow users to download and install Python packages from the Internet by using simple commands. .
This project is an XML oriented Web Framework that relies on python for expansion of XML data into web pages, while keeping code and content sepearted. Coupling this with CSS allows for complete page formatting and styling without touching python code
A simple Python-based web framework for viewing and editing genealogy data. Allows users to browse your family tree and make changes, such as adding new people, adding or deleting images, or notes and stories. Works with GEDCOM v5.5 and Spyce.
The PyJTF supports the test-driven development of Javascript code
using tests written in Python. It executes the code under test in the IE
environment under Windows (Win32). Allows greater productivity in testing Javascript code.
Radix is a RAD framework for creating native XML web applications. Complete web applications can be created without programming knowledge using XML, XSLT, XPath and related technologies. Radix can be extended using Java, JavaScript, Python, and Tcl.
A web development framework; includes an application server which provides a persistent object cache and transaction support, an intelligent HTML parser, multi-threaded scripting, multiple scripting language support within a single OO framework.
The Open Distributed Framework project is aimed at developing an open-source, cross-platform framework for distributed, high-performance physical modelling and simulation.
Opensource tkinter framework for grouping small applications together
tKroopy is an opensource Tkinter framework for building groups of small to medium GUI applications - Think of it as a hub for your applications and scripts.
tKroopy includes some additional widgets to make building applications faster.
Prudence is an opensource container and framework for scalable web frontends and network services, based on proven REST principles. It comes in several flavors: Python, Ruby, Clojure, JavaScript, PHP and Groovy.
